morally neutral

道德中立

频率: 6.05.5 每百万词

Having no moral quality; neither good nor bad.

没有道德品质;不好也不坏。

morally neutral = 道德中立 (没有道德品质;不好也不坏。)

  • A scientific discovery is often morally neutral until its application.科学发现本身常常是道德中立的,直到其应用。
  • Some argue that art can never be truly morally neutral, as it always reflects values.有人认为艺术永远不可能真正道德中立,因为它总是反映价值观。
  • The decision itself was morally neutral, but its consequences were not.决定本身是道德中立的,但其后果并非如此。
  • Technology is often presented as morally neutral, but its impact depends on human choices.科技常被呈现为道德中立的,但其影响取决于人类的选择。
  • Is it possible for any human action to be completely morally neutral?任何人类行为都有可能完全道德中立吗?
  • He claimed his research was morally neutral, focusing purely on objective facts.他声称他的研究是道德中立的,纯粹关注客观事实。
  • The tool itself is morally neutral; it's how you use it that matters.工具本身是道德中立的;重要的是你如何使用它。
  • From a certain philosophical perspective, all existence might be considered morally neutral.从某种哲学角度来看,所有存在都可能被认为是道德中立的。
  • She struggled to maintain a morally neutral stance on the controversial issue.她努力在有争议的问题上保持道德中立的立场。
  • The legislation aimed to be morally neutral, avoiding judgment on personal beliefs.该立法旨在道德中立,避免对个人信仰做出判断。
